Zur Gattung Pseudodoros Becker, 1903 (Diptera, Syrphidae) By Kassebeer C.F. Dipteron 3(1): 73-92, 2000
according to this revision, Pseudodoros is a monotypic Old World genus; the correct name for what we call here P. clavatus is Dioprosopa clavata.
